《微型计算机原理》求取 ⇩

前 言1

目 录1

第一章绪论2

第一节微处理器与微计算机的发展史2

一、 电子数字计算机的发展史2

二、 微处理器与微型计算机的发展史3

三、 微型计算机发展趋势4

第二节微处理器和微型计算机的定义4

一、 电子计算机的基本组成及工作原理4

二、 微处理器与微型计算机6

一、 能获得最佳性能/价格比8

二、 积木式,适应性强8

第三节微型计算机的特点8

三、 可靠性高9

四、 容易掌握9

五、 微型计算机是硬件和软件相结合的产物9

第二章运算基础10

第一节进位计数制10

一、 十进制数的表示10

二、 二进制数的表示10

三、 二进制的特点11

四、 八进制数的表示12

五、 十六进制数的表示12

六、 八进制和十六进制的比较13

一、 十进制数转换成二进制数14

第二节不同进位制数之间的转换14

二、 二进制数转换成十进制数16

第三节原码、补码与反码16

一、 机器数与真值16

二、 计算机中的反码和补码形式17

三、 原码、补码与反码的关系18

第四节运算方法22

一、 加、减法运算22

二、 溢出判断24

三、 乘、除运算25

第五节运算电路27

一、 基本逻辑门27

二、 加法电路34

第六节数的定点及浮点表示法37

第七节数字和字符代码40

一、 数字代码40

二、 字符代码42

练习45

第三章存贮器47

第一节存贮器概述47

一、 主存贮器与外部存贮器47

二、 存贮器的分类48

第二节半导体存贮器49

一、 存贮单元寻址49

二、 半导体随机存取存贮器(RAM)51

三、 RAM的组成54

四、 只读存贮器(ROM)56

练习59

第四章微处理器结构60

第一节几个基本概念60

一、 总线用基本逻辑电路60

二、 总线60

三、 堆栈62

四、 定时64

第二节微处理器内部结构65

一、 算术逻辑部件ALU66

二、 寄存器66

一、 主要性能68

第三节微处理器实例——Z80微处理器68

三、 控制部件68

二、 Z-80 CPU结构69

三、 Z-80 CPU引脚说明76

练习77

第五章指令系统78

第一节概述78

第二节计算机指令的基本格式79

一、 指令的基本内容79

二、 指令的长度80

第三节微型计算机指令寻址方式81

一、 直接寻址(又称扩展寻址)81

三、 同接寻址82

二、 页面寻址82

四、 立即寻址83

五、 立即扩展寻址83

六、 变址寻址83

七、 相对寻址83

八、 寄存器直接寻址83

九、 寄存器间接寻址84

十、 隐含寻址85

十一、位寻址85

第四节指令的种类86

一、 数据处理指令86

三、 程序处理指令90

二、 数据传送指令90

四、 状态管理指令92

第五节Z-80指令系统93

一、 数据传送指令93

二、 数据处理指令102

三、 程序处理指令112

四、 状态管理指令116

练习116

第六章Z-80CPU时序118

第一节概述118

第二节Z-80CPU典型时序分析119

一、 取指令操作码周期119

三、 输入或输出周期121

二、 存贮器读或写周期121

四、 总线请求/响应周期123

五、 中断请求/响应周期124

六、 非屏蔽中断响应125

七、 暂停状态的脱离125

八、 实例126

练习127

第七章汇编语言及程序设计基础128

第一节概述128

一、 什么是汇编语言128

二、 交叉汇编和自汇编129

三、 汇编程序的类型130

四、 汇编源程序的执行方法131

第二节汇编语言的格式133

一、 字符与行长度133

二、 大写与小写 (133

三、 标号(名字)133

四、 操作码134

五、操作数134

六、注释136

第三节伪指令137

一、 名字说明137

二、 数据说明138

三、 外部标号说明和入口标号说明139

五、 代码段说明伪指令140

四、 汇编结束说明140

六、 程序名说明142

七、 插入文件说明142

八、 条件汇编144

九、 宏定义和宏调用146

第四节汇编语言程序设计148

一、 基本设计方法150

二、 算术运算程序设计161

三、 子程序166

第五节宏汇编171

一、 参数在宏中的应用171

二、 宏定义的嵌套和宏调用的嵌套173

三、 宏定义中的标号174

四、 宏指令对Z-80指令系统的扩充175

五、 宏指令的特点和它与子程序的区别176

第六节一个汇编语言程序应用实例——PID程序177

一、 分析课题177

二、 选择算法177

三、 程序流程178

四、 编程178

第七节微型计算机的程序编制184

一、 问题的定义184

二、 程序设计184

三、 编码185

五、 文件编制186

四、 调试和测试186

六、 修改设计187

练习188

第八章输入/输出及中断系统189

第一节I/O寻址方式189

一、 存贮器对应I/O方式189

二、 专用I/0方式190

三、 存贮器对应I/O方式与专用I/O方式的比较190

第二节I/O控制方式190

一、 CPU与I/O之间的接口信号190

二、 I/O控制方式191

一、 概述197

第三节中断197

二、 中断响应与处理程序198

三、 中断优先顺序199

第四节Z-80中断系统208

一、 概述208

二、 Z-80非屏蔽中断209

三、 Z-80可屏蔽中断210

四、 Z-80CPU状态转换图213

五、 Z-80CPU快速中断程序215

六、 Z-80中的优先权排队线路216

七、 Z-80中断控制逻辑217

一、 组成及信号功能简介220

第一节Intel 8212接口电路220

第九章输入/输出接口电路220

二、 8212芯片的应用222

第二节Z-80 CTC计数器定时器电路223

一、 Z-80CTC结构223

二、 Z-80CTC的引脚与功能说明225

三、 Z-80CTC的工作方式226

四、 Z-80CTC初始化程序的编制228

五、 CTC应用举例230

第三节Z-80 PIO可编程序并行接口232

一、 Z-80PIO结构232

二、 Z-80PIO引脚及功能说明234

三、 Z-80PIO初始化程序的编制237

四、 PIO时序241

五、 PIO应用举例243

第四节Z-80 SIO可编程序串行接口259

一、 UART的工作原理260

二、 Z-80 SIO串行I/O接口263

第五节 Z-80微计算机最小系统272

一、 最小微计算机系统框图272

三、 I/O接口电路与CPU的连接举例276

练习276

附录278

附录一Z-80指令汇总表278

附录二Z-80单板计算机监控程序ZBUG简介291

二、 存贮器与CPU的连接举例2773

1986《微型计算机原理》由于是年代较久的资料都绝版了,几乎不可能购买到实物。如果大家为了学习确实需要,可向博主求助其电子版PDF文件(由朱德森,孔志辉编著 1986 华中工学院出版社 出版的版本) 。对合法合规的求助,我会当即受理并将下载地址发送给你。

高度相关资料

微型计算机实用原理(1989 PDF版)
微型计算机实用原理
1989 北京:科学技术文献出版社;重庆分社
控制工程导论(1988.02 PDF版)
控制工程导论
1988.02 西北工业大学出版社
微型计算机原理  下( PDF版)
微型计算机原理 下
辽宁大学物理系
微型计算机原理  上( PDF版)
微型计算机原理 上
辽宁大学物理系
单片微型计算机原理( PDF版)
单片微型计算机原理
微型计算机原理(1983 PDF版)
微型计算机原理
1983
Z80微型计算机原理( PDF版)
Z80微型计算机原理
微型计算机原理应用( PDF版)
微型计算机原理应用
北京:机械工业出版社
微型计算机原理(1992 PDF版)
微型计算机原理
1992 北京:水利电力出版社
微型计算机原理(1985 PDF版)
微型计算机原理
1985 西北电讯工程学院出版社
微型计算机原理(1989 PDF版)
微型计算机原理
1989 西安:西安交通大学出版社
微型计算机原理(1995 PDF版)
微型计算机原理
1995 北京:中国人民大学出版社
微型计算机原理(1996 PDF版)
微型计算机原理
1996 北京:人民邮电出版社
微型计算机原理(1996 PDF版)
微型计算机原理
1996 上海:上海交通大学出版社
微型计算机原理(1998 PDF版)
微型计算机原理
1998 北京:清华大学出版社